Compatibility
HENRI WRIST STRAP is ultra-lightweight, comfortable, and ideal for smaller cameras. HENRI WRIST STRAP fits any medium-compact cameras with side-lugs.
It fits all Fujifilm cameras (X-Pro series, X100-series, etc), all Micro 4/3rds cameras (Olympus, Panasonic, etc), all Leica cameras (Leica Q, M, film M, etc), and most film cameras.
HENRI WRIST STRAP does NOT fit DSLR’s nor the Ricoh GR. For RICOH GR, buy ERIC KIM STRAP.
HENRI WRIST STRAP is worn on your wrist and the leather adjustment loop can tighten and secure the camera to your hand.
Story Behind HENRI STRAP
The HENRI neck strap, HENRI wrist strap, and ERICKIM strap are both 100% handmade, crafted with care from start to finish. Each HENRI strap is hand-made by two of our friends, Lan and Uyen who are a leather craftsmen and artists in Saigon.
Cindy and I are their clients and collaborators, and we worked together with them to design the strap. Since they are our friends and collaborators, they have always set the price for the straps to cover their costs and labor. Lan and Uyen source the leather, handmake the straps during the weekdays between music gigs, and ship them to California from Saigon.
Rather than mass produced, these are handmade in small, limited-quantity batches in order to preserve a level of excellent craftsmanship and quality. Each strap is unique.
Once they get to California, Eric and I, (and now with the help of our loving and supportive family) work to quality check, finish, and package each strap:
